What does Temmy mean?

Temmy is spelling variation of Temmi. Temmi is Frisian equivalent of Tem.

Variants of Temmy

Temmi, Tem, Them, Detmer

How popular is the name Temmy?

Temmy is a rare baby name in United States where it may not be used now. Temmy is a common name in Indonesia while somewhat familiar name in Nigeria and Philippines. According to our estimate, at least 1000 people have been bestowed Temmy around the globe.
